Homeschooling News Roundup

Sun Feb 01 2026

Listen

In this episode of Continuing Education, we unpack January 2026’s biggest homeschool stories: Virginia’s record 49.5% enrollment surge since 2019, new 529 tax changes that unlock up to $20,000 per child for homeschool expenses, and why expanding school choice programs may threaten homeschool freedom by adding strings and regulation.
